Limerick Womens Mini Marathon Print

The 12th annual Limerick Women's Mini Marathon takes place on Sunday 3rd October at 2pm at the University of Limerick Campus.

Part of the 8km course will be in County Clare on the UL North Campus crossing the spectacular Living Bridge, approx 1km from the finish.

You can run, jog or walk as an individual, part of group and / or for your chosen charity.

Full details and on-line entries are available at www.limerickminimarathon.com

10th Irish Coaching Forum, 11th Septeber 2010. Dublin Print

The 10th Coaching Forum “Playground to Podium” promises to be the most exciting and challenging forum to date. It will address coaching issues at all levels of Sport & Physical Activity.

The key notes and workshops will be delivered by National & International experts, with practical knowledge and experience of dealing first hand with real coaching issues.

The forum takes place on Saturday 11th September in the Dublin Convention Centre.

 

For full information and booking, see the Coaching Ireland Website .

 
New Clare U 12 Basketball League? Print
 

Are you interested being involved with a Clare Underage Basketball League? If so, Clare Sports Partnership are holding a meeting on Tuesday the 7th September at 8.30pm in the offices of the Clare Sports Partnership, Unit 1, Westgate Business Park, Kilrush Road, Ennis. The meeting will run until 9.30pm and will focus on an under 12 boys and girls league. Anyone interested in entering a team, interested in being trained as a coach or volunteering for the league, is welcome. Badminton Ireland Schools Programme Print

 

Badminton Ireland is committed to providing all young people with the opportunity to take part in badminton and to helping schools provide their students with the opportunity to participate.

Did you know that badminton is one of the most popular sports in Ireland?  It's a sport that you can play throughout your life, both socially and competitively and it's also one of the few sports with equal participation of both sexes. Some Schools leagues and competitions start early in September so make sure your entries are in to the Local organisers on time!
